2 Kentucky Prison Escapees Captured in Mexico
Associated Press
EL PASO —
The two remaining Kentucky State Penitentiary escapees were apprehended at a hotel in Juarez, Mexico, on Sunday, the FBI said. James Blanton, 29, convicted of murder, and Derek Quintero, 26, convicted of robbery and kidnaping, were arrested without incident by heavily armed Mexican police, an FBI agent said. They were among eight prisoners who escaped June 16.
